ABSTRACT

INTRODUCTION: Controversy exists regarding the optimal management of AO/OTA 43. C3 pilon fractures. Open reduction and internal fixation (ORIF) is the gold standard treatment, but serious soft tissue and infectious complications have been previously reported. Minimally invasive strategies using hexapod ring fixation (HRF) with supplemental limited internal fixation have been used to reduce the incidence of complications. Previous studies have included heterogeneous types of pilon fractures, with non-comminuted injuries being more likely to be treated with ORIF and complex fractures receiving HRF treatment. To our knowledge, no studies have compared the complications and reoperation rates between ORIF and HRF exclusively for C3 fractures. METHODS: Retrospective study comparing 53 patients treated for AO/OTA 43.C3 pilon fracture with ORIF or HRF in a trauma level I center with at least a two-year follow-up. Patients treated between January 2015 and January 2019 received ORIF and those treated between January 2019 and January 2021 received HRF. Complications were divided into two groups: minor (superficial infection and malalignment) and major (non-union, deep infection, and amputation). Reoperations, prevalence of ankle osteoarthritis, and requirement for ankle arthrodesis/total ankle replacement were registered. RESULTS: We included 30 and 23 patients in the ORIF and HRF groups, respectively. The overall complication rate was similar in both groups, with 50% and 56,5% of the patients having complications in the ORIF and HRF groups, respectively (p:0,63). Minor complications were significantly more prevalent in the HRF group (p<0,001) whilst the ORIF group had a significantly higher rate of major complications (p<0,01). Superficial infections were highly prevalent in the HRF group (47,8%), as they were related to half-pin or K-wire infections. Deep infection was present only in the ORIF group, with 20% of the patients developing this major complication (p:0,03). Non-union rate, reoperations, ankle osteoarthritis, and the need for arthrodesis or ankle replacement showed no significant differences. CONCLUSION: In AO/OTA 43.C3 fractures, HRF is safe and effective, achieving high union rates with a significantly lower rate of major complications compared to ORIF. According to our results, ORIF should be used cautiously for these types of fractures, considering the increased risk of deep infection.

La enfermedad de Kawasaki (EK) es una vasculitis aguda de vaso mediano que afecta principalmente a niños menores de 5 años, que de no ser tratada, se asocia al desarrollo de aneurismas de las arterias coronarias en aproximadamente el 25% de los casos. Típicamente la EK se presenta con fiebre, cambios mucocutáneos y linfadenopatía. Sin embargo, EK es una enfermedad excepcional en la que las formas incompletas de la enfermedad son muy comunes y a menudo asociación sintomatologías atípicas. Éstas pueden crear un desafío diagnóstico para los tratantes y retrasar el inicio de la terapia. No existe un gold standard para el diagnóstico de EK pero hay estudios de laboratorio y hallazgos ecocardiográficos que permiten apoyar el diagnóstico en casos incompletos. El estudio con ecocardiograma debe realizarse lo más pronto posible cuando se sospecha el diagnóstico, pero no debe retrasar el inicio de tratamiento. El objetivo de la terapia en EK es disminuir el riesgo de desarrollar aneurismas de las arterias coronarias y de esta forma, la morbimortalidad asociada a dicha condición. El propósito de esta revisión es conocer las características clínicas y las posibles formas de presentación de esta patología, además del tratamiento actual.


Kawasaki disease (KD) is an acute vasculitis of the medium vessel that mainly affects children under 5 years old, which if it's not treated, is associated with the development of coronary artery aneurysms in approximately 25% of all cases. Typically, KD presents with fever, mucocutaneous changes and lymphadenopathy. However, EK is an exceptional disease in which incomplete forms of the disease are very common and atypical presentations often occur. These presentations may create a diagnostic puzzle for pediatricians and may delay the start of therapy. There is no specific study for the diagnosis of KD but there are laboratory studies and findings in ECG that support the diagnosis in atypical cases. The echocardiogram study should be performed as soon as possible when the diagnosis is suspected, but should not delay the treatment. The goal of treatment in KD is to reduce the risk of developing aneurysms of the coronary arteries and thereby decrease the morbidity and mortality associated with this condition.
